Cure for ADHD in Adults: Understanding, Managing, and Living with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der
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der (ADHD) is often related to children; nevertheless, lots of adults continue to experience its impacts. This condition can exceptionally affect different aspects of life, including career, relationships, and individual well-being. Understanding ADHD, checking out effective management techniques, and attending to common mistaken beliefs are essential actions toward leading a fulfilling life for those affected.
Understanding ADHD in Adults
ADHD is identified by consistent patterns of negligence and/or hyperactivity-impulsivity that disrupt operating or development. In adults, signs might manifest differently than in kids, leading to challenges in numerous elements of life. Below is a table summing up typical signs of ADHD in adults.
Symptoms of ADHD in AdultsDescriptionInattentionTrouble focusing, lapse of memory, lack of organization, and distractibility.HyperactivityExcessive talking, uneasyness, and a constant sense of being "on the go."ImpulsivityProblem waiting in lines, interrupting others, and making hasty choices.Psychological DysregulationMood swings, disappointment tolerance, and difficulty managing stress.Low MotivationDifficulties in setting and accomplishing individual objectives.Medical diagnosis and Assessment
Getting a proper diagnosis is vital for adults who believe they have ADHD. A comprehensive assessment generally includes:
Clinical Interview: A mental health expert gathers information about the person's history, signs, and functional impairments.Self-Reported Questionnaires: Standardized tools such as the Adult ADD Treatment ADHD Self-Report Scale (ASRS) may be utilized.Behavioral Assessments: Input from household, pals, or coworkers can provide valuable insight into the individual's performance.Treatment Options
While there is no conclusive "treatment" for ADHD, numerous efficient treatments can assist handle signs and enhance quality of life. Treatment can include medication, therapy, and way of life changes. Here's a breakdown of common strategies:
Treatment OptionsDescriptionMedicationStimulant medications (like Adderall) and non-stimulant alternatives (like Strattera) can assist improve focus and reduce impulsivity.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T)CBT is effective in assisting grownups with ADHD establish coping strategies and restructure unfavorable idea patterns.TrainingADHD coaches can assist people with company, time management, and goal-setting.Support systemGetting in touch with others who share comparable experiences can provide emotional support and practical recommendations.Lifestyle ChangesRegular exercise, a healthy diet plan, appropriate sleep, and mindfulness practices such as meditation can significantly benefit ADHD symptoms.Table: Effectiveness of Treatment OptionsTreatment OptionEffectivenessConsiderationsMedicationHighMight have side results; needs medical guidance.CBTModerate to HighTime-intensive; may need multiple sessions.TrainingModerateRequires inspiration; varies depending upon the coach.Support GroupsModeratePeer-led; advantages vary based on individual engagement.Lifestyle ChangesVariableMay take time to see outcomes; highly individualistic.Lifestyle Modifications to Consider
For many grownups, adopting specific way of life modifications can help manage ADHD signs effectively. Here are some recommendations:
Establish Routines: Develop a day-to-day schedule to promote consistency and minimize forgetfulness.Set Clear Goals: Break larger jobs into smaller sized, workable steps and set deadlines to help preserve focus and motivation.Reduce Distractions: Create a dedicated workspace and decrease environmental interruptions to enhance concentration.Practice Mindfulness: Engage in mindfulness practices, such as meditation or yoga, to improve focus and reduce stress.Workout Regularly: Physical activity can help in reducing hyperactivity and improve mood, promoting overall well-being.Frequently asked questions About ADHD in Adults
Q1: Can ADHD be detected in adulthood?Yes, ADHD can be
diagnosed in the adult years. Many individuals are unaware they have it up until later in life, often when they face obstacles in work or relationships. Q2: What is the most efficient treatment for
adult ADHD?The most efficient treatment varies by person; nevertheless, a combination of medication and cognitive behavior modification(CBT)has revealed promising results for lots of grownups. Q3: Are there any natural treatments for ADHD?While there are no scientifically tested natural treatments, some individuals find that dietary modifications, routine exercise
, and meditation help handle signs. Q4: How can I support an enjoyed one with ADHD?Support can consist of being patient, helping them organize tasks, motivating treatment, and advocating for their requirements in social and expert settings. Q5: Is there a link between ADHD and other mental health disorders?Yes, grownups with ADHD may be more likely to experience other conditions such as anxiety, anxiety, and compound utilize disorders

. While there is no definitive treatment for ADHD in adults, it is a condition that can be effectively managed with the right tools and methods. Comprehending the symptoms, seeking proper medical diagnosis and treatment,

and making lifestyle adjustments can substantially improve a person's quality of life. With assistance and efficient management, grownups with ADHD can grow and lead productive, gratifying lives.
